With the improving of production level and using requirements of special tube,the higher requirements for the precision and speed measurement of its static parametersare raised. Because our current measurement equipment can not meet the demand, it hasgreat value in engineering for us to develop a set of measuring device of special tubestatic parameters which is high in precision, efficiency and automation. This paperpresents some key technology which occurs in the research of the camber of specialtube.Under the research background of artillery curvature measurement system, thispaper studies some details of image measurement technology based on grasping itsmeaning.Firstly, the principle and structure of the researched curvature measurementsystem are introduced, and the key technologies that we faced in the development aresummarized. Secondly, CCD camera nonlinear distortion correction, calibration andpixel equivalent coefficient acquirement are analyzed thoroughly. Lastly, the classicaledge detection algorithm is expounded. According to the particularity of scale imageand extraction, the line/column mean gray fitting algorithm based on compensating andcorrecting suiting to extracting scale scribed line is proposed. Meanwhile, the proposedalgorithm is confirmed through contrast experiment. The result shows that it not only ispracticable and stable, but also improves the precision and speed of scale scribed lineextraction.At last, some problems in the system are in-depth analyzed, and the direction ofthe following research is prospected.
